Here are the ideas behind it :

Taurus : when you invest in a flying monster, you want 2 things, flying PSun IF but you’ll also want to have him in combat someday. So earthing rod/top/charmed shield auto-include for me. That’s 600 pts and usually at 25%, blood of hashut is added to get a lil more punch in combat and might let you kill some stuff you wouldnt in a 25% max lord.

Target saturation : you’re bringing your general on a please shoot me mount. Your opponent will have to make some choices. 3 warmachines/1k’daai/1taurus. What are you going to let through ?

K’daai : depending on the situation there will always be 1 or 2 khan to block frenzy baiting/clear chaff out of the way since there is no centaurs for the delivery this time.

Deployment : Stubborn IF protecting the machines with hobos on each side, can reform in ranks of 3 if hero in potential bad matchup. K’daai/khans on their own on a flank. Prophet going for flank positions on low init armies and sniping threats like canon/lvl 4.

You can probably switch cores with 1 20 hobos and 27 blunder if you want to move the warmachines up on deployment.

Doombeard
I think you would be paying too much on magic lvls you don't need in this scenario. K'daai already at M9 and already at 4+ ward. Would be cool on a table though.

As for the lvl 4 on lammasu vs. Bale taurus. I think the lammasu wins the trade-off. Smaller print agains cannonballs/templates. You get 2+ ward on magic missile also and a free channel dice. Vs. Flame template/higher T/W, F10 will still hit on 2's. I don't have a lammmasu model though.

The carpet would be even better if it wasn't so pricy. There's no place for it for a death magic deliverer when you are forcing IF.

Geist
I don't see where they could be scary when you know what they do. Go with the matchup, younhave so many things to take care of them. In competitive lost you will usually see 4x10 in pairs of 2 with 2 blocks of saurus. They are slow, so no stress like you would be facing ogres or cavalry lists. 1 warmachine shot and they are gone. The taurus will never be in range of the 4 units at the same time. You fly, have a breath weapon, terror. And they are not usually in thr general's bubble. Yes, you have bigger targets for machines, but againstnthis specific matchup, you will usually have 1 more round if shooting.

They don't have cannons, shooting is splt between rider and mount, scared of turn 1, deploy it behind cover, and he will hit on 7+ and lose poison.

Even if you are not patient and just charge it and they manage to not flee on the reaction :
On a basis on 10 shots : 6.6 shots goes to taurus, 1 poison wounds goes through average. Ill take it anyday at 5 W, even at double shots I would go.
